Job Description

Steven Camp MD Plastic Surgery & Aesthetics is a dedicated plastic surgery practice located in Fort Worth, Texas, led by Dr. Steven Camp and his team. The practice is deeply committed to creating a positive and exceptional patient experience from the very first contact. This commitment is embodied in their unique philosophy encapsulated by the hashtag #HappyCamper, representing honest, open, and collaborative relationships with both women and men who trust the team to provide top-tier aesthetic care. This esteemed practice is widely recognized for its comprehensive approach, blending plastic surgery with nonsurgical aesthetic treatments, delivered in a warm, professional, and patient-centered environment.

The position available is for a Front Office Coordinator, a vital role ensuring every patient interaction is handled with the utmost professionalism, warmth, and efficiency. This role is primarily responsible for managing a high volume of new patient calls, emails, and web inquiries each month. Beyond administrative tasks, the coordinator develops an in-depth knowledge of the practice’s offerings, including advanced skincare products, nonsurgical treatments, and surgical procedures. This knowledge enables the coordinator to confidently guide and educate patients, enhancing their overall experience and satisfaction. The onboarding period includes dedicated training and education, empowering the new hire with expertise in a variety of aesthetic treatments, such as Sciton laser treatments, SkinPen microneedling, Hydrafacial and DiamondGlow facials, injectables, dermaplaning, chemical peels, medical-grade skincare, medical weight loss, hormone replacement therapy, and peptide therapies.

Working within Steven Camp MD Plastic Surgery & Aesthetics, the Front Office Coordinator becomes part of a clinical team that values continuous learning, autonomy, and innovation. The role requires strong communication skills to manage incoming calls, coordinate appointments, obtain treatment consents, handle patient payments, and maintain accurate records in the electronic medical record system. Additionally, the coordinator plays a key part in managing patient rewards programs and contributing to skincare product sales. The practice upholds core values that include providing the best possible patient experience, maintaining honesty and openness, embracing education, and cultivating a supportive and team-oriented culture. Employees are expected to embody the three A’s: Affable, Able, and Available, alongside attributes such as humility, hard work, kindness, and enthusiasm as a #HappyCamper.

This in-person position operates Monday through Friday, 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M, with occasional Saturdays as needed. The hourly pay range for this role is $23.00 to $27.00, reflecting the emphasis on both experience and customer service excellence. Benefits include paid time off, health insurance, dental and vision insurance, a 401(k) matching program, staff discounts on skincare and aesthetic treatments, and a supportive work environment encouraging professional growth. The practice strongly prefers candidates with a bachelor’s degree, a minimum of two years of customer service or patient-facing experience, strong computer proficiency, a typing speed of 50+ WPM, and excellent interpersonal skills. The ideal candidate will demonstrate reliability, punctuality, attention to detail, and the ability to multitask in a fast-paced setting with a positive, friendly presence that enhances the patient journey from start to finish.
